Is Vancouver or Istanbul cheaper?
Istanbul is generally cheaper. COL+Rent: Vancouver 63.1 vs Istanbul 32.2 (NYC=100).
What is $1,000/mo in Vancouver worth in Istanbul?
$1,000/mo of purchasing power in Vancouver equals ~$510/mo in Istanbul using COL adjustment.
